VICKY FERGUSON Obituary

VICKY DIANE

FERGUSON

Mar. 4, 1951 – Feb. 6, 2025

Vicky Diane Ferguson (Jarrell), 73, of El Centro, CA, passed away on February 6, 2025. Born in Brawley, CA, on March 4, 1951, she spent her entire life in El Centro. She graduated from Central Union High School in 1969.

Vicky dedicated a large portion of her career as a bookkeeper working for the late Louise Willey and later retired from Meadows Union School District in 2015.

Her early years as a mother were filled with love and creativity, as she baked and decorated birthday cakes and cookies for her children and their classmates. Vicky was known for her strong alto voice and sang at numerous weddings and funerals, touching many lives with her heartfelt performances.

In her retirement, Vicky cherished her time with her church family, participating in ladies groups and Bible classes. She also found joy in traveling, with highlight trips including cruises to Alaska with her family and the Caribbean with her sisters. Above all, her greatest passion was her grandchildren, two living in Imperial, CA, and the other four residing in Minnesota.

Preceded in death by her husband, Sid Ferguson, who passed away in 1992, Vicky is survived by her son, TAD Ferguson of El Centro, CA; her daughter, Katrina Wherry (Ferguson), and her husband, Sean Wherry, along with their children, Ferguson, Charlie, Julia Mae, and Hayston, all of Cold Spring, MN. She is also survived by Rimmie and Scott Mosher, who she considered her daughter and son-in-law, and their children, Scotty and Kalei, who she considered her grandchildren, all of Imperial, CA. Additionally, Vicky is survived by her siblings, Jere Jarrell, Sandra Wooten, Randall Jarrell, Ron Jarrell, Pamela Dameron, and is preceded in death by Suni Dungan.

Vicky was a faithful Christian and lifelong member of the Church of Christ in El Centro, CA. Her greatest joy was her grandchildren, her family, and her church family. A celebration of Vicky's life will be held near Easter time, with details to be provided later.
